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
110543 890 68990438 82672 906074
884364745 415731819 276085
884364745 415731819 276085
50 500731 7805332236
All about undefined
Interested in learning more?
884364745 415731819 276085
50 500731 7805332236
See more
07165 9976869 8398298817
93266 62041 908471128
See more
2882204 77659 7716354541
0716025 3457801 9280082270
See more